Kansas State University and NIFA Co-sponsor Meeting on Agricultural Security
A meeting on agricultural security, co-sponsored by Kansas State University and NIFA, was held on June 12–13, 2012, at the NIFA Waterfront Centre. The meeting focused on the future of the three national networks—the Extension Disaster Education Network (EDEN), the National Plant Diagnostic Network (NPDN), and the National Animal Health Laboratory Network (NAHLN)—that are supported, in part, by the USDA-NIFA Food and Agriculture Defense Initiative (FADI). The primary purposes of the meeting were to identify and prioritize the research, education, and extension/outreach/service issues that are critical to each network; to focus on continuing enhancement of the networks; and to break ground on potential inter-network activities.
